CCTV Captures Ajmer Chain-Snatching Attempt Foiled By Bystanders
A retired doctor and his wife were riding home in Ajmer.
Two men on another motorcycle came close to them.
One man tried to take the woman’s chain.
The motorcycles lost balance and fell near a speed breaker.
The woman shouted, bringing nearby people to help.
A bystander confronted the suspects, and locals chased one of them.
Reports disagree about whether one suspect was caught or escaped.
Police examined the CCTV footage and searched for the person who got away.
A retired doctor and his wife were allegedly targeted by two motorcycle-borne men in Ajmer’s Civil Lines area.
CCTV footage shows a pillion rider attempting to pull the woman’s chain as both vehicles lost balance near a speed breaker.
One report says the pillion rider used a fake pistol and eventually took the chain, though this detail is not included in the other account.
A bystander and other residents confronted the suspects; one alleged accomplice was chased down and caught, reportedly beaten before police arrived.
Reports differ on the motorcycle rider’s fate: one says he escaped, while another describes locals catching both men before stating that one fled.
